Another massage therapist I met had coined this term for certain clients who like deep, to the point of painful massages... "pain freaks".

I have never in my career ever gotten a complaint about not going deep enough. Most clients who try to challenge me, convinced I won't be able to provide them with deep enough massage, usually eat their words. However, I seem to have built up a large clientele of these "pain freaks".

I'm finding I can't handle this type of work anymore. I don't want to do deep work and I'm not sure that I even believe in it anymore, if that makes sense? The problem is, I still have some of these clients. I don't know how to break it to them that I'm just not going to do that type of therapy anymore.

I have one client for example, that has always tried to tell me what to do during the session. He wants me to work only on his upper traps and rhomboids for the entire hour! Then he tells me he didn't feel things start to "loosen up" until the last ten minutes of the session. When I explain (over and over again) that he will feel more relief the following day and even more the day after that, he still insists on booking another appointment within the week, convinced he will need it. He always ends up cancelling that appointment because, ta-da, like magic, he feels better a day or two after his massage! I wonder why? :smt017 I even called this guy once and explained that I had a thumb injury and couldn't do deep work, did he still want to keep his appointment? He did, and I used gentler techniques. He then re-booked for a week later insisting that he still needed a deep tissue masssage. :undecided:

The problem I'm encountering is that these clients feel they really need deep, deep work. I don't think they are in touch with their bodies enough to appreciate the more gentle methods. I'm personally learning to appreciate MFR and finding the work quite profound! My clients however, don't have that same appreciation and insist on having the same old, same old sessions. I feel like I have to start all over marketing to a new type of client? What do you think I should do?

Yes, I was in exactly this situation four years ago. I was very, very popular for doing excrutiatingly painful work. About 1/2 of my clients were "pain freaks" and the other half were just used to the idea of painfully deep massage, though I would gladly lighten up if asked. However, I was learning more about massage and how the body works, and realized that the approach my clients were used to was NOT what I wished to continue doing long-term. I gradually moved away from the painful work, incorporating different techniques, changing how much pressure I used, working at different tempos, etc. Some clients weren't very happy, but I attempted to educate all of them. Some moved on to find other MTs, and others decided they liked my new approach anyway.

Since then, I have been relatively fearless about bringing new methods/concepts into my practice. Some require a bit more up-front explanation and client consent, while others fit into my existing work seamlessly. There will always be some clients who prefer the "old Jason" (whatever that was) and decide to try other MTs. But there will always be some who like the "new Jason" and the way they feel after a session with me. In general, I have found that every time my practice evolved in a new direction that I truly preferred, my client list grew.

I also didn't feel it was my responsibility to help the old clients find someone else who did the work that I no longer cared to do. If they asked, I could suggest a few names, but I didn't know if any of those MTs were really anything like me. My efforts at client education seemed a better long-term course of action because they might actually learn something useful and perhaps be more understanding of any other MTs they might try.

This kind of client needs a very direct approach. The next time he comes in, tell him you have learned and practiced some more effective methods than what he typically requests. Tell him these new methods are less painful and much more efficient, and that you plan to make them a regular part of your sessions with him. If he balks (at all), remind him that doing the same thing over and over, expecting different results, is one of the definitions of insanity... and then tell him you aren't crazy and you'd like him to not be crazy too. :altwink: Injecting a little humor should help, but basically the session is yours to control. If he still wants you to bang away on his upper back, tell him that he's asking you to waste time when it's his pecs and anterior shoulder girdle that need the work... and that you won't do it anymore. You know that approach won't work and ethically you need to exercise your best professional judgement during treatment. If he doesn't want you to perform your duties in a professional, ethical, and knowledgeable way, he will need to find another MT willing to take his money for ineffective work. :twisted:

My guess is he'll either give you a chance (or two) and see how it works, or that will be the last time you see him. Win-win! :grin:

For those with "pain freaks" for clients, have you found that many of them are unable to tolerate the pressure by consciously or unconsciously tightening up? Or are most of them able to handle the deep pressure and pain? I've had MANY clients request deep pressure and repeatedly request that I go deeper because "no pain, no gain!" - but at the same time they're holding their breath and tensing up. I once had a client who wanted the deepest massage I could give - he wanted it to hurt. When I got to my medium-deep pressure, he had already begun tensing up and holding his breath, unable to tolerate the pressure. At the very same time he said "that doesn't hurt. I barely feel that." He repeated it MANY times. Yet it was obvious that it was too deep for him. I did my very best to educate him about the threat for injury for both him and me when I try to work muscles that he's contracting. Could NOT get through to him. The nice thing about having a bag of tricks with many different skills is that you can market your work in multiple ways. If you have only been doing deep tissue for people who want to feel the pressure, you will be pleasantly surprised as your skills expand. Mixing other types of work and people into the practice will also help save your hands over the years.

Do you have a website? If so, begin to change the focus and look of the site. Tailor it to what you are wanting to bring into the practice. Want more women? Add more flowery speech, textures, pictures and possibly even the font. Want to put a positive spin on "saving your hands"? Mention that MFR will allow you to practice more years. Even though you and I know that you can practice many years no matter what the style (if you do the work correctly), at the same time, this gives you a feel to the website which is informative about a personal reason why you choose this style of work. People reading the site will resonate with a practice that is effective and lighter, without you having to go into a lot of explanation.

If you like MFR and know it, start advertising with it. And, another way to educate your clients who recieve your original style of bodywork, is by telling them you are going to be spending about half the session with your new technique (whatever you choose) along with some of the original style of work. This will give them a few opportunities to experience your new style and sessions while making the decision if they want to continue with you (many times they will) for their future sessions.

You can also set a deadline as to when you will completely introduce the new technique/s into your practice, and begin telling clients now. "By May 1, 2010 I will be completely switched over to the nnn technique/s."

Start off your new clients with the new technique/s. Make sure and find out who referred these clients, so you are aware of what they are expecting when walking through your doors. If they are a referral from an old and incompatable style of your work, be prepared to educate before the client gets on the table. What you don't want is for someone to walk in expecting one thing, put them on the table and do something else, only for them to leave dis-satisfied and not knowing why. A little education with someone like this will keep them from bad-mouthing your work, by the nature of their expectation being dashed. Have the names of a few therapists who work in the style you will be quitting on hand in case someone asks for a referral.

I think this will help make the transition easier for everyone involved, if you don't want to change immediately by stopping cold turkey. :)

I have noticed that most of the people that request the “over the top" deep pressure that I am not comfortable giving have other issues. Quite often they are the ones that have injured themselves starting an exercise routine that is too aggressive. Then they come for some "really deep work" to “fix” the injury. They play hard, diet hard and generally don't listen to their bodies. It seems to me to be a form of self punishment.

Interestingly, today I have one of these people on my schedule. The MT this person has seen in the past is no longer available. The previous MT did nothing but very deep work. So...today I will practice sticking to my boundaries and offering some education with the massage.

I think I'd like to point out with this (especially with clients who had a previous therapist who did that kind of work) is to be careful not to discount or "put down" other therapists who do that. While you might not agree with the work they do, they are a fellow MT still. Carefully chosen words like "I have found that such and such modality is actually more effective even though it feels lighter" and others that have been mentioned in previous posts are less condescending to both the client and your colleagues than something such as "Going too deep will only hurt you", "I don't believe in causing people pain" and the like.

A new client came today by referral. He was in pain. He used to go and see an MT and bragged that she said he could take more pressure than any other of her patients.

Then I asked, and how was that for you? Well, he said, I always left there sore, but looser.

I explained that what I do is very different to what he is used to, and he might feel like nothing is happening at first. Then he started to feel the pain going and the fascia softening. He left very happy.

One can always explain that, just like there is a wide range of massage, perhaps from Therapeutic Touch to Shiatsu, there is also a range of Myofascial Release, perhaps from Rolfing to CST.
